Output 17b7f6fd3264ccc95c60fc9adda711258d7d71694f92912c937a69cfcba90833:0

value
144100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a43ab03a2d3cf64ad8424cf2a1b7e6b9e27ba24a OP_EQUAL
address
3GfP3k97d7emhcMx7Tv9Rpsxjr37kEhL8p
transaction
17b7f6fd3264ccc95c60fc9adda711258d7d71694f92912c937a69cfcba90833
confirmations
223876
spent
true